MIGUEL ROMO MEDINA SENADOR DE LA REPÚBLICA SEN. MIGUEL BARBOSA HUERTA PRESIDENTE DE LA MESA DIRECTIVA Presente - o Distinguido Presidente: O Me permito informar a esa Mesa Directiva que usted preside, que en mi calidad de Miembro Permanente de la Asamblea Parlamentaria del Consejo de Europa, asistí a su 3 a Sesión Ordinaria, misma que se llevó a cabo del 22 al 26 de junio del presente año, en la Ciudad de Estrasburgo, Francia. Entre las actividades realizadas por un servidor, destaco de manera relevante mi intervención en el debate abierto, con el tema: "LA PARTICIPACiÓN DE LOS JÓVENES COMO MOTOR DE LA DEMOCRACIA" Y que adjunto al presente, incluyendo el listado oficial de oradores que fue puesto a consideración del Parlamento . Por otra parte, informo también a usted que quienes formamos parte de la Delegación Mexicana, sostuvimos una reunión privada con la Señora Anne Brasseur, Presidenta de dicho Parlamento; a quien independientemente del intercambio de ideas, se le presentó en forma impresa la Ley de Niñas Niños y Adolescentes que fue editada por el Senado de la República. La participacioacuten de los joacutevenes como motor de la Democracia

Las Tecnologiacuteas de la Informacioacuten y las Comunicaciones son sin lugar a duda las herramientas maacutes importantes y con mayor crecimiento del siglo XXI Su apertura dinamismo y flexibilidad permiten que una gran cantidad de informacioacuten recorra grandes distancias y llegue a nuestras manos en fraccioacuten de segundos

Los joacutevenes como principales usuarios de estas tecnologiacuteas aplicadas en la optimizacioacuten de las redes sociales tienen a su alcance la posibilidad de conocer de primera mano la informacioacuten que diacutea a diacutea se genera en la palestra puacuteblica y que es de gran utilidad para el fortalecimiento de la Democracia

El proceso de retroalimentacioacuten entre Gobernantes y Mandantes se facilita gracias al internet los controles de la sociedad sobre los mandatarios contienen ahora una mayor supervisioacuten pero esto no es suficiente se debe buscar una intervencioacuten y participacioacuten directa con mayor profundidad y alcance

Desafortunadamente los joacutevenes tienden a mantenerse al margen de la vida de los partidos poliacuteticos Ellos hacen sentir su opinioacuten a traveacutes de otros n1ecanismos efectivos en la inmediatez pero su participacioacuten no debe limitarse uacutenicamente a la emisioacuten de opiniones Debemos de alentar y motivarlos para que no solo actuacuteen en poliacutetica en ese terreno digital sino para que se involucren ademaacutes en la vida

democraacutetica de nuestras naciones a traveacutes de la accioacuten poliacutetica de forma viable y activa

La Democracia hay que acercarla a los ciudadanos y sobre todo a los joacutevenes para que podamos fortalecerla diariamente La participacioacuten democraacutetica no debe remitirse uacutenicamente a la emisioacuten del voto no a toda accioacuten directa en la toma de decisiones es por ello que la inclusioacuten de los joacutevenes en la vida partidaria y electoral vendriacutea a renovar e inyectar fuerza dinamismo y sensibilidad a las instituciones poliacuteticas de todos los paiacuteses

Debemos adaptar las ideologiacuteas postulados e historia que resumen los hechos que conforman nuestra nacioacuten a la conformacioacuten de los principios doctrinales que tienen los partidos y si en este proceso de transicioacuten logramos la participacioacuten de la juventud encontrariacuteamos entonces una legiacutetima y real adecuacioacuten al contexto actual

Vale la pena realizarnos el siguiente cuestionamiento iquestla ausencia de una participacioacuten integral de la juventud es parte de las crisis que debilita a las democracias yo considero que si pues al lograr la participacioacuten directa de los joacutevenes podremos conocer de primera mano las condiciones socioeconoacutemicas y culturales de nuestras comunidades

No tengo duda de que la juventud fortalece la Democracia es por ello que los joacutevenes deben participar de manera proactiva en las tareas de Gobierno y en las funciones de representacioacuten legislativa
